In Florida, 77‑year‑old Nelson Smart was arrested on allegations that he tried to take a 12‑year‑old girl waiting at the school bus stop to his minibus under the pretext of taking her to school.

In the state of Florida, United States, 77‑year‑old Nelson Smart was arrested on allegations that he tried to take a 12‑year‑old girl waiting at the school bus stop into his minibus and drive her away. Prosecutors reportedly sought a permanent prison sentence for the suspect, who had previously been convicted of a sexual offense against children.
School officials immediately reported.
The incident that occurred in Polk County, Florida, came to light after a report from school officials. According to the sheriff’s statement, while a 12‑year‑old girl was waiting at the school bus stop, Nelson Smart arrived in a white minibus and offered to take the child to school.
The girl rejected the offer.
The student who declined Smart’s offer told the school bus driver what had happened. After the driver reported the incident to school administration, officials filed a report with the sheriff’s office.
Police units that launched an investigation on the report identified the suspect and apprehended Smart.
Former Sexual Offender Draws Attention
Authorities announced that Nelson Smart had previously been convicted of a sexual offense against children. The suspect faced charges of deceiving people. It was stated that the offense was considered a serious crime under Florida law.
According to a story on Fox 13 News, Smart was held in custody on a $25,000 bond while prosecutors pursued a permanent prison sentence.
